The Procedure Unveiled

RCT becomes necessary when the pulp inside a tooth becomes inflamed or infected due to deep decay, cracks, or trauma. In contrast to popular belief, the procedure is more manageable than it may seem. It is a routine and highly effective treatment that saves teeth from extraction.

The process typically involves the following steps:

  • Diagnosis: The dentist at the best dentist for root canal treatment in South Delhi examines the tooth using X-rays to vie the extent of damage and identify the infected pulp.
  • Anaesthesia: Local anaesthesia is administered to ensure the patient is comfortable throughout the procedure.
  • Access Opening: The dentist makes a small root opening to reach the infected pulp.
  • Cleaning and Shaping: The infected pulp is removed, and the inner chamber is precisely cleaned and shaped to prepare for the filling.
  • Filling: The cleaned pulp space is then filled with a biocompatible gutta-percha material to seal the canal and prevent infection.
  • Restoration: In many cases, a crown is placed on the tooth to restore strength and functionality.

Dispelling Myths

  1. Root Canals Are Painful: Advances in dental technology and anaesthesia have made RCT at the best dentist for root canal treatment in South Delhi relatively painless. Patients can experience mild discomfort, but the procedure is designed to alleviate pain caused by the infected pulp.
  2. Root Canals Cause Illness: This myth has been debunked by scientific research. There is no evidence linking RCT to systemic diseases. The procedure is a safe and effective way to preserve natural teeth.

The Benefits of Root Canal Therapy

  1. Pain Relief: Root canal therapy effectively eliminates the pain associated with infected pulp, providing long-lasting relief.
  2. Preservation of Natural Teeth: Unlike extractions, root canal therapy preserves natural teeth, maintaining the integrity of the dental arch.
  3. Improved Oral Health: Root canal therapy prevents bacteria from spreading and promotes oral health by removing infection.
  4. Aesthetic Appeal: Using crowns or other therapeutic measures, root canal-treated teeth can look and function like natural teeth.
